Eagles Stay Unbeaten In Last Four
September 29, 2015 | Men's Soccer
Lewis scores in the 17th minute
GAME INFORMATION
Score: Boston College 1, Rhode Island 1 (2ot)
Records: Boston College (6-2-1), Rhode Island (5-4-1)
Location: URI Soccer Complex, Kingston, R.I.
Attendance: 320
BC HIGHLIGHTS
- Junior Zeiko Lewis scored the Boston College goal in the 17th minute. He is now tied for the team lead in goals (4) with freshman Trevor Davock.
- Senior Alex Kapp made five saves in goal in his second start of the season.
TURNING POINT
Rhode Island's Dominik Richter scored the equalizer in the 33rd minute to cap the scoring and force the 1-1 draw.
HOW IT HAPPENED
- Boston College forced URI keeper Nils Liefhelm to make a couple of early saves before Lewis struck in the 17th minute when he beat him to the near post.
- In the 26th minute, a BC foul in the box gave Rhode Island a penalty kick. Carlo Davids took the chance and shot wide of the target.
- Seven minutes later, Richter forced a turnover in the midfield and found Emil Jesman Sunde. He fed it back to Richter for the goal to tie the match.
- The Rams had a 10-5 advantage in shots in the second half but Kapp made four saves to get the match into overtime.
- BC took all seven shots in the two overtime periods but couldn't secure the game-winner.
- Davock had four of the shots and URI's Liefhelm was forced to make three saves.
UP NEXT
Boston College will host No. 6 Wake Forest on Friday night at 7 p.m. in Newton.
